What problem does it solve?

ME-2 scoring provides a structured, quantitative method to compare tradeoffs among profiles using the four dimensions P, C, D, and E.

Core Features & Use Cases

  • Formula: (P + C + D + E) / 4
  • Dimensions: P (Completeness), C (Clarity), D (Differentiation), E (Economy)
  • Use Cases: quickly evaluate multiple profiles to inform decision-making, prioritization, and risk-aware tradeoffs.

Quick Start

Score profiles by applying the ME-2 formula to their P, C, D, E values and compare the resulting averages across options.
